       A vast array of daily activities took place .
          The first day entailed our first plenary session moderated by Dr Stephan Gift and was entitled ' What do we have ?' The first speakers were Mr. Mustafa Toure , Manager , Sustainable Development Unit Caricom Secretariat  and Dr. Avril Siung Chang ,Environmental Health Advisor , Pan American Health Organisation . These two avid speakers  addressed the topic 'Resources of the Caribbean Sea and their Economic Value.'Another speaker Mr. Kishan Kumarsingh, Technical Coordinator , Environmental Management Authority ,who elaborated on ' The effects of Climatic Changes on the Caribbean '
        Later during that same day Workshop Orientation occurred . The workshops conist of the groups Environmental Theatre , Information Technology , Community Interaction , Video Documentation and Science.
 

ENVIRONMENTAL THEATRE

These students decided to show their artistic talent by choreographing their own dance and skit about the sea and its environs. Soothing oceanic sounds and the sounds of the ocean pounding  against the surf  could be heard in the backgrond of this scenic skit. The participants showed their myriad talents by depicting various marine animals such as various  types of fish as well as plant life such as phytoplankton  .
